Nice spot overlooking lake muskoka, quite good food, and very friendly, prompt service. What was particularly good about our meals was that they didn't hold back on the expensive stuff: the fish and chips had lots of fish and a very moderate amount of batter, and my pork dish had a very generous amount of pork (it was a little dry but still a good dish overall). The vegetables were good too. Be forewarned that they only take cash now.

Excellent food and even better hospitality! We chose the "trust us you will love it" option on the menu and the chef did not disappoint. The patio has a really nice view of the dock and the lake, and offers both sun and shade as well. Take cash with you as they may not accept electronic transfers, or it may just be that when we visited it was not working... they do have an ATM machine at the location in case you need to take out any cash. Also, the restaurant has its own separate parking so do not park at the plaza ... Google will not take you to the parking so make sure you keep an eye out for the signs along the highway.
